The global compaction equipment market size, essential for various construction and industrial applications, has witnessed a consistent growth trajectory over the years. As of 2023, the market value stood at approximately USD 5.33 billion, a figure that encapsulates the sector’s significant impact on the broader economy. With projections indicating a growth at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 4.30% from 2024 to 2032, the market is expected to reach an estimated value of USD 7.79 billion by 2032. Key Benefits
Compaction equipment plays a pivotal role in construction and agricultural activities by enhancing soil stability, reducing soil settlement, and increasing load-bearing capacity. This equipment is crucial for preparing the ground for construction projects, laying foundations, and constructing roads, offering benefits such as improved project efficiency, cost reduction, and enhanced safety standards. The precision and effectiveness of modern compaction equipment also minimize environmental impact by reducing the number of passes required to achieve desired compaction levels, thus saving time and fuel.
Key Industry Developments
The compaction equipment market has seen significant technological advancements aimed at improving efficiency, operator comfort, and environmental sustainability. Innovations such as intelligent compaction systems, which use GPS and onboard computer systems to optimize compaction levels and monitor project progress, represent a leap forward in the industry. Additionally, the development of electric and hybrid compaction machines aligns with the growing emphasis on reducing carbon emissions across industries.

Restraining Factors
Despite its growth potential, the compaction equipment market faces several challenges. High initial investment costs and maintenance expenses can deter small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) from purchasing new equipment. Moreover, the availability of rental and used equipment presents a competitive challenge to new equipment sales. Environmental regulations and the push for more sustainable construction practices also require companies to invest in cleaner, more expensive technologies.
Market Segmentation
The global compaction equipment market is segmented based on type, application, and geography. By type, the market is categorized into rammers, vibratory plates, rollers, and others, catering to different construction needs and soil types. Application-wise, the market spans road construction, utility, landscaping, and other sectors, reflecting the equipment’s versatility. Geographically, the market is analyzed across North America, Europe, Asia-Pacific, Latin America, and the Middle East Africa, with each region presenting unique growth opportunities and challenges.
